QBP^ZL1 – Pesquisa Requisições de Laboratório
A pesquisa de internamentos é efectuada através de uma mensagem QBP^ZI1, sendo que esta mensagem não existe especificada no HL7, foi criada pela LIGHt para satisfazer a necessidade de pesquisas em internamentos.
A pesquisa de requisições laboratoriais é efectuada através de uma mensagem QBP^ZL1, esta mensagem foi criada pela LIGHt para satisfazer a necessidade de efetuar pesquisas em Requisições de Laboratório. Como resposta a esta mensagem os resultados são devolvidos através de uma mensagem RSP^ZL1 de acordo com os parâmetros definidos.
Os parâmetros de pesquisa para estas mensagens são:
Parâmetros aceites | Descrição |
---|---|
@Code | Código |
@Domain | Módulo (Domain Code) |
@VisitNumber | Nº episódio |
@OrderID | ID análise |
@ExternalOrderID | ID externo da análise |
@OrderStatus | Estado do pedido |
@OrderControlCode | Controlo de requisições |
@OrderBeginDate | Data Inicio Pedido |
@OrderEndDate | Data Fim Pedido |
@Priority | Prioridade |
@AppointmentID | ID da marcação |
@SpecimenID | Specimen ID |
@PatientID | ID do utente |
@ProcessNumber | Nº de processo |
@ HealthCardNumber | Nº SNS |
Posteriormente é devolvida uma resposta (RSP^ZL1) com os registos das requisições de laboratório de acordo com os parâmetros indicados na pesquisa efectuada.
Query Profile
Query Statement ID : | ZL1 |
Type: | Query |
Query Name: | Find Order Lab |
Query Trigger (= MSH-9): | QBP^ZL1^QBP_Q11 |
Query Mode: | Both |
Response Trigger (= MSH-9): | RSP^ZL1^RSP_ZL1 |
Query Characteristics: | @Code; @Domain; @VisitNumber; @OrderID; @ExternalOrderID; @OrderStatus; @OrderControlCode; @OrderBeginDate; @OrderEndDate; @Priority; @AppointmentID; @SpecimenID; @PatientID; @ProcessNumber; @ HealthCardNumber |
Purpose: | Pesquisa de Requisições Laboratoriais |
Response Characteristics: | Envia as Requisições Laboratoriais com as características seleccionadas. |
Exemplo de uma mensagem Pesquisa de Requisições Lab
Neste exemplo são pesquisadas todas as novas requisições de laboratório "@OrderControlCode^NW" para o utente com ID 233 "@PatientID^233".
MSH|^~\&|HL7_DEFAULT|DEV|HOS|DEV|20150511100000||QBP^ZL1^QBP_Q11|701c063d-00da-45ca-a133-f19b7e167953|D|2.5 QPD|ZL1^Find Order Lab|||@PatientID^233~@OrderControlCode^NW RCP|I|20^RD DSC|1| |
---|
Como resposta a esta query são devolvidos dois registos de novos pedidos de laboratório para o utente com ID "233". A informação acerca dos dois novos pedidos de laboratório é passada nos segmentos PV1, ORC, TQ1 e OBR. A informação acerca do utente com o ID "233" é passada no segmento PID.
Resposta:
MSH|^~\&|HOS|DEV|HL7_DEFAULT|DEV|20150511100000||RSP^ZL1^RSP_ZL1|1fd4af10-574b-4d3c-ad18-3a0f1432761d|D|2.5| MSA|AA|701c063d-00da-45ca-a133-f19b7e167953| QAK||OK|Z01^Find Order Lab|2|2|0 | QPD|Z01^Find Order Lab ||@PatientID^233~@OrderControlCode^NW | PID|1||233^^^HOS^NS~^^^^SNS||LAST_NAME^FIRST_NAME^MIDDLE_NAME^^^^L||19551001000000|F |||RUA DA MORADA^^CIDADE^DISTRITO^9999-999^PT^N^CONCELHO^999999||^PRN^PH^^^^^^^^^217153527|||||99000837^^^HOS | PV1|1|LAB||||||||||||5|||||14000052^^^HOS|||||||||||||||||||||||||20150325000000|||||||V | ORC|NW||15561325^HOS|||| |||||1852^UTILIZADOR^TESTE|||||||||||||||||AP | TQ1|1|1^Un|||||20150325000000|||||||| OBR|1||15561325^HOS|A21656^DESIDROGENASE ALFA-HIDROXIBUTIRICA (HBDH), S^HOS|||||||||||||||||||||||1&Un^^^20150325000000^^U| PID|2||233^^^HOS^SNS~^^^^SNS||LAST_NAME^FIRST_NAME^MIDDLE_NAME^^^^L||19551001000000|F|||RUA DA MORADA^^CIDADE^DISTRITO^9999-999^PT^N^CONCELHO^999999||^PRN^PH^^^^^^^^^217153527|||||99000837^^^HOS | PV1|2|LAB||||||||||||5|||||14000052^^^HOS|||||||||||||||||||||||||20150325000000|||||||V | ORC|NW||15561328^HOS|||||||||1852^UTILIZADOR^TESTE|||||||||||||||||AP | TQ1|2|1^Un|||||20150325000000|||||||| OBR|2||15561328^HOS|A26337^DNA VIRAL - PESQUISA NCO ESPECIFICADA^HOS|||||||||||||||||||||||1&Un^^^20150325000000| |
---|